Output d4acf5c96baaf7ef5c7d03c1c5f2752aea6552763228dae1282cf2450eb52991:31

value
69744632
script pubkey
OP_0 OP_PUSHBYTES_20 ed8309993e61063ec2ee511f3fed7f46019ea845
address
bc1qakpsnxf7vyrrashw2y0nlmtlgcqea2z9qnfr8j
transaction
d4acf5c96baaf7ef5c7d03c1c5f2752aea6552763228dae1282cf2450eb52991
spent
true